Executive Summary: Reshoring Financial and Operational Strategy
Reshoring supply chain management in the manufacturing industry is the business practice of bringing sourcing back to a company’s home country after it was previously moved overseas. Supply chain reshoring should be treated as a capital allocation decision and a working-capital discipline strategy.
The move from offshore to domestic manufacturing can replace high logistics costs, excess safety stock, and tariff exposures with localized direct labor and automation-driven overhead. This document outlines the financial controls, cost accounting frameworks, and plant workflows needed to execute a reshoring initiative while protecting gross margins and shortening cash conversion cycles.
Pre-Reshoring Checklist: Financial and Operational Prerequisites
Before any capital expenditure (CapEx) is authorized or domestic Purchase Orders (POs) are issued, finance and operations must establish the following baseline controls:
1. ERP & Supply Chain Visibility Parameters
- MRP/DRP Parameter Review: Ensure Material Requirements Planning (MRP) parameters reflect current offshore lead times (e.g., 90–120 days) and projected domestic lead times (e.g., 14–21 days). If they do not, the transition can create excess inventory.
- Multi-Level BOM Rollups: Map the Bill of Materials (BOM) down to Tier 3 suppliers. A domestic Tier 1 assembly source is not enough if its raw inputs still depend on the same disrupted offshore ports.
2. Transition Governance Committee
- Form a local task force: Plant Manager, Supply Chain Manager, Financial Controller, and HR Director.
- Accountability: Tie performance bonuses to zero-downtime transition metrics and strict adherence to the CapEx budget.
3. Total Cost of Ownership (TCO) Financial Models
- Move beyond standard Purchase Price Variance (PPV).
- Integrate Weighted Average Cost of Capital (WACC) to calculate the carrying cost of holding 12 weeks of transit inventory. Include historic costs of expedited air freight, premium freight variances, and yield loss from offshore quality defects.
4. Domestic Vendor Master Setup & Credit Negotiation
- Establish credit facilities with domestic suppliers. Use shorter lead times to negotiate extended Days Payable Outstanding (DPO) terms (e.g., 60-90 days), matching or exceeding the cash flow profile of offshore letters of credit.
Reshoring Operations Sequence
Step 1: Conduct the TCO and Absorption Costing Analysis
Start with true landed cost. Offshore unit costs often look favorable until inbound freight, port duties, demurrage, and standard shrinkage are factored in.
- Action: Build a parallel standard cost model in your ERP sandbox. Compare the offshore landed cost against the domestic unit cost plus domestic inbound freight.
- Shortcut: Experienced controllers often apply a flat 18-24% annual carrying cost rate to average inventory values. It is a fast way to quantify working capital savings from domestic sourcing.
2: Audit Dependencies and Categorize Risk
Pull an inventory aging and usage report, including FIFO/LIFO analysis.
- Action: Categorize components into A, B, and C classifications based on volume and strategic importance. Target “A” items with high historical premium freight variances for initial reshoring.
3: Vet and Contract Domestic Suppliers
Send RFQs, then audit prospective domestic vendors on site.
- Control Metric: Assess capacity utilization. A vendor running at 95% capacity cannot absorb your volume spikes. Review its internal cycle counting controls as well; poor inventory accuracy at the supplier can quickly become your line-down crisis.
4: Develop a Phased Cut-Over Plan
Avoid single-phase cut-overs.
- Action: Run offshore and domestic supply in parallel. Maintain offshore POs at a reduced volume (e.g., 30%) while ramping domestic POs to 70%.
- Accounting Impact: Expect temporary unfavorable PPV during this phase because dual-sourcing reduces volume discounts. Quarantine this variance in a separate GL account to avoid distorting underlying gross margins during the 5-day month-end close.
5: Capital Expenditure in Automation
Domestic direct labor rates can create unfavorable labor rate variances. This requires an offset: measurable gains in throughput and labor productivity.
- Action: Deploy CapEx into robotics and automated workflows.
- Financial Mechanics: Shift the cost structure from variable direct labor to fixed manufacturing overhead, then recalculate overhead absorption rates based on the new, higher machine-hour capacity. Ensure the CapEx payback period aligns with the projected working capital savings.
6: Execute Production and Tune Controls
Start domestic production.
- Control Metric: Institute weekly blind cycle counts on reshored components. Any deviation between physical and perpetual inventory (ERP) that exceeds 2% requires immediate root cause analysis. Monitor Direct Labor Efficiency Variances daily.
Realistic Scenario: Discrete Manufacturer (Woodfires & Lawnmowers)
Context: A $40M turnover manufacturer of heavy discrete goods, including woodfires and mowers, is reshoring production of cast-iron grates and stamped aluminum decks from Asia. The objective is to consolidate a formerly $60M two-site operation into a higher-throughput single site.
The Financial Challenge:
The offshore standard unit cost for an aluminum deck is $45. The domestic quote is $65. At 50,000 units annually, this appears to be a $1,000,000 margin erosion.
The TCO & Working Capital Position:
| Cost Element (Annualized for 50k units) | Offshore (Asia) | Domestic (Reshored) | Variance (Impact) |
|---|---|---|---|
| Base Component Cost | $2,250,000 ($45/u) | $3,250,000 ($65/u) | ($1,000,000) Unfavorable |
| Ocean Freight & Tariffs | $600,000 | $80,000 (LTL Freight) | $520,000 Favorable |
| Expedited Air Freight (Historic Ave) | $150,000 | $10,000 | $140,000 Favorable |
| Inventory Holding Cost (WACC @ 12%)* | $180,000 | $30,000 | $150,000 Favorable |
| Offshore QA Scrap/Rework | $100,000 | $20,000 | $80,000 Favorable |
| Total Landed & Carrying Cost | $3,280,000 | $3,390,000 | ($110,000) Unfavorable |
Note: Offshore requires 16 weeks of safety/transit stock ($1.5M tied up). Domestic requires 2 weeks ($250k tied up). Cash freed from working capital = $1.25M.
The CFO Response: The company closes the final $110,000 gap by investing $450k in automated welding and stamping robotics. This reduces domestic direct labor headcount by 4 FTEs, saving $240,000 p.a. Net positive P&L impact: $130,000 p.a. Payback on CapEx: < 2 years. The freed-up $1.25M in working capital also allows the business to pay down high-interest revolving credit.
Common Mistakes to Avoid (The Controller’s Perspective)
Underestimating the Domestic Labor Gap
The Error: Assuming you can staff a third shift by hiring direct labor alone.
The Consequence: Heavy unfavorable labor efficiency and labor rate variances due to forced overtime. Without simultaneous investment in automation, the standard costing model fails, and gross margins come under pressure.
Ignoring the Sub-Tier Supply Chain
The Error: Reshoring Tier 1 assembly, but relying on Tier 1 to import Tier 2 raw materials (e.g., specialty alloys or electronic controllers) from the original offshore sources.
The Consequence: Limited resilience. When global shipping halts, your domestic supplier claims Force Majeure, resulting in unabsorbed factory overhead for your plant.
Severing Offshore Ties Too Quickly
The Error: Canceling all offshore POs the moment domestic First Article Inspection (FAI) passes.
The Consequence: A line-down scenario if the domestic vendor fails to scale. Expedited air freight costs can erase a quarter’s profitability. Run parallel supply until the domestic vendor sustains a 95%+ Delivery In-Full, On-Time (DIFOT) rating for 90 days.
Fixating Solely on Unit Cost
The Error: Procurement bonuses tied exclusively to PPV (Purchase Price Variance).
The Consequence: Procurement rejects domestic sourcing due to the higher base price, ignoring the material balance sheet drag from excessive offshore safety stock. Align KPIs to Total Landed Cost and Inventory Turns, not just PPV.
Frequently Asked Questions
How does reshoring impact the overall cost of Supply Chain Management?
Component-level PPV usually worsens. The offset comes from lower premium freight variances and warehousing overhead, as well as reduced working capital carrying costs. In many cases, the net impact is a stabilized gross margin and improved cash flow forecasting.
What is the difference between reshoring, nearshoring, and friendshoring?
- Reshoring: Repatriating manufacturing to the home country (maximizing local tax credits and eliminating customs).
- Nearshoring: Moving to a contiguous or nearby nation (e.g., the US to Mexico) to utilize shorter trucking routes while reducing direct labor cost.
- Friendshoring: Sourcing from geopolitical allies to mitigate tariff risks and intellectual property theft, even if geographically distant.
